WebBracket (s): A contest format in which bowlers are divided into groups (the "brackets"), and each bowler is paired against another bowler in the group in the first round of what is … WebMore frequently by far is the 3-10 split left predominantly by right handed bowlers. Left handed bowlers leave the 2-7 split. Both splits are left because the bowling ball contacted the head pin and "chopped" off the 2 pin or 3 pin and thereby left the 7 or 10 pin as accompanying pins. WebCommon Reasons for leaving the 10 Pin or 7 Pin. Usually, left-handed bowlers struggle with the issue of the 7 pin refusing to fall down. The main cause for this is having a poor entry. You are probably coming in too light, which causes the 2 pin to hit the back of the 4 pin and this brings it in front of the 7 pin.
